WebAug 24, 2024 · Simply put, house equity is the difference between the value of your home, and the amount of outstanding mortgage loans or liens you have borrowed against it. For example, if your home is worth $750,000, and you have an outstanding mortgage balance (or balances) totaling $250,000, then total equity in the house is equal to $500,000. WebMar 13, 2024 · Jane wants to keep the house, so she needs to buy out John’s ownership share of the equity. To do this, she needs to pay John $240,000. She decides to fund the buyout by refinancing the mortgage.
